>   Hi,
>
>   The last release of our MOD (Vampire-Slayer) saw the addition of built
in
> bots. An unforeseen side effect of this is that the player rankings of
> www.CSports.net (powered by GameSpy) are now dominated by bot players. Can
> someone tell me how these stats are colated? Would filtering bot kills
from
> the log files do the trick or is there more to..
>
>   thanks.
